How Long Does It Take for FemiLift in Limerick?
Introduction to FemiLift
FemiLift is a revolutionary non-surgical treatment designed to address various feminine health issues, including vaginal tightening, urinary incontinence, and sexual dysfunction. This treatment utilizes CO2 laser technology to stimulate collagen production and improve the overall health and function of the vaginal tissues. In Limerick, FemiLift has gained popularity due to its effectiveness and minimal downtime.
Procedure Duration
The actual FemiLift procedure typically takes around 30 minutes to complete. This timeframe includes the preparation, application of the laser, and post-treatment care instructions. The quick duration of the procedure makes it an attractive option for women seeking a convenient solution to their feminine health concerns.
Recovery Time
One of the significant advantages of FemiLift is its short recovery period. Most patients can resume their normal activities immediately after the procedure. However, it is recommended to avoid strenuous activities, such as heavy lifting or intense exercise, for a few days to ensure optimal healing. Mild discomfort or slight swelling may occur, but these symptoms usually resolve within a day or two.
Number of Sessions Required
The number of FemiLift sessions required varies depending on the individual's condition and desired outcomes. Typically, a series of three to four sessions spaced about four weeks apart is recommended for optimal results. Patients often notice improvements after the first session, with continued enhancement after each subsequent treatment.
